This plan needs to be designed to help you to achieve your career aspirations. For this task you need to complete a career plan that allows you to identify your development needs. This career plan will allow you to identify your strengths, weaknesses, opportunities and threats (SWOT analysis). You will also need to include a qualifications map and a qualifications gap. The qualifications map will illustrate the path you will take to enable you to obtain the relevant qualifications you require. The qualifications gap will highlight the gaps that you have in qualifications to be suitable for the job you have chosen. Create a SWOT analysis and a written document as evidence of your findings.
